Signs You Might Have a Hidden Water Leak in Your Home
- Water bill suddenly spikes
- Musty odour near walls or floors
- Stains or bubbling on ceilings or drywall
- Reduced water pressure
- Warm or damp spots on the floor
- Running water sounds when taps are off

Calgary Plumbing Leak Detection: How We Find the Source
- Camera inspections inside pipes and drains
- Thermal imaging to find hidden hot spots from pipe leaks
- Pressure testing to identify loss across your system

How much water can a small leak waste?
Even a pinhole leak can waste over 1,000 litres a week. That’s a lot of water and a big bump in your bill.

How do plumbers detect leaks?
At Harper’s, we use specialized tools for plumbing leak detection in Calgary. This includes thermal imaging to spot hidden heat changes, acoustic sensors to listen for water movement behind walls, moisture meters, pipe inspection cameras, and pressure testing to identify drops in flow.
